What Characters Should I Avoid When Naming My File

March 26, 2018

• Common characters that cannot be used anywhere in a file name:

o Tilde (~)
o Number/Pound sign (#)
o Percent (%)
o Ampersand (&)
o Asterisk (*)
o Braces ({ })
o Parenthesis ( )
o Backslash (\)
o Colon (:)
o Angle brackets (< >)
o Question mark (?)
o Slash (/)
o Plus sign (+)
o Pipe (|)
o Quotation marks (“,’)
o Dollar sign ($)
o Exclamation point (!)
o At sign (@)

• Don’t use the period character consecutively in the middle of a file name.
• Don’t start or end your filename with a space, period, hyphen, or underline.
